Transaction 183648757f51cbf1973410c778a9e8caf15213fcb3d057eeedd3573a4057757a
1 Input
1 Output
-
183648757f51cbf1973410c778a9e8caf15213fcb3d057eeedd3573a4057757a:0
- value
- 8043604
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1d0c20935f9990b0d4b96de37603c5703736034 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mb17vHXsDeDTarKTAN94zkDz2WyK6Ps7N